487,660 (four hundred eighty-seven thousand six hundred sixty) is an even 6-digit number. It is a composite number with 24 divisors, and factors as 2² × 5 × 37 × 659. Its proper divisors sum to 565,700, more than the number itself, making it an abundant number. Written other ways, in hexadecimal, 0x770EC.
